Today's activity was to learn about what is an clerihew. A clerihew is a whimsical, four-line biographical poem. Did you know that Edmund Clerihew Bentley is the one who invented clerihew. Our create part was to make a clerihew. We could make it on Minecraft, Animation, Scratch or any other thing we learnt in the summer learning journey. I tried to make my clerihew but I didn't get one thing right which is that the first and second lines rhyme with each other, and the third and fourth lines rhyme with each other.
